WebAltering the original fuse type or size or the circuit breaker size with a larger size will endanger the electrical circuit wiring and components. NEVER UP SIZE A CIRCUIT BREAKER. Up-sizing a circuit breaker or fuse will cause the circuit wiring to over heat. Overheated electrical wiring will create a serious fire hazard. WebApr 12, 2024 · How close can things be to an electrical panel? 29 CFR 1910.303 (g) is a federal law. The electrical panels must have a minimum of three feet of clearance in front of them and a minimum clearance width of 2.5 feet if the equipment is less than 600 volts.

WebDec 18, 2024 · The most common type of application within a commercial facility are three-phase delta primary to wye secondary step-down type transformers. Industry standard sizes for 480- to 120/208-volt wye transformers are commonly 15, 30, 45, 75, 112.5, 225, 300 and 500 kilovolt-amperes.
